Alfa Laval signs an agreement to acquire the cryogenics business from the French group Fives
Alfa Laval (ALFVY) has signed a binding put-option agreement to acquire Fives Cryogenics business unit for EUR 800 million on a cash and debt-free basis. The France-headquartered target company is a world-leading expert in cryogenic heat transfer and pump technologies, with over 60 years of experience in manufacturing cryogenic heat exchangers and pumps for gas liquefaction.
Fives Cryogenics employs more than 700 people, operates manufacturing facilities in France, China, and Switzerland, and generated revenue of approximately EUR 200 million in 2024. Looking forward, the company is expected to generate revenue of EUR 200-250 million and be neutral to positive to Alfa Laval's group margin.
The transaction, subject to regulatory approvals and works council consultation, will be funded through existing liquidity and debt financing, with expected closing during 2025. The acquired business will operate as a new separate unit within Alfa Laval's Energy Division.
